What companies run services between Bundoora, VIC, Australia and North Melbourne, VIC, Australia?

Yarra Trams operates a vehicle from Settlement Rd/Plenty Rd #66 to La Trobe St/Spencer St #119 every 15 minutes. Tickets cost $6 and the journey takes 1h 13m. Alternatively, you can take a vehicle from Settlement Rd/Plenty Rd #66 to Dryburgh St/Haines St via La Trobe University/Plenty Rd #60, La Trobe University, Eye & Ear Hospital/Victoria Pde, and St Vincent's Hospital/Victoria Pde in around 1h 59m.
